Iraq - Centrifugal Raw Sugar Production
Since 2014, Iraq Centrifugal Raw Sugar Production grew 2.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 120 among other countries in Centrifugal Raw Sugar Production at 1,218 Metric Tons. Iraq is overtaken by Benin, which was ranked number 119 at 1,223 Metric Tons and is followed by Macedonia with 1,000 Metric Tons. India lead the ranking with 32,017,633.43 Metric Tons in 2019, a decrease of 6.7% compared to 2018. Brazil, Thailand and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kazakhstan witnessed the best average annual growth at +47.3% per year, while Syria recorded the worst performance at -48.8% per year.
